NAME
JSON::RPC::Server::Daemon - JSON-RPC sever for daemonSYNOPSIS
# Daemon version #-------------------------- # In your daemon server script use JSON::RPC::Server::Daemon; JSON::RPC::Server::Daemon->new(LocalPort => 8080); ->dispatch({'/jsonrpc/API' => 'MyApp'}) ->handle(); #-------------------------- # In your application class package MyApp; use base qw(JSON::RPC::Procedure); # Perl 5.6 or more than sub echo : Public { # new version style. called by clients # first argument is JSON::RPC::Server object. return $_[1]; } sub sum : Public(a:num, b:num) { # sets value into object member a, b. my ($s, $obj) = @_; # return a scalar value or a hashref or an arryaref. return $obj->{a} + $obj->{b}; } sub a_private_method : Private { # ... can't be called by client } sub sum_old_style { # old version style. taken as Public my ($s, @arg) = @_; return $arg[0] + $arg[1]; }
DESCRIPTION
This module is for http daemon servers using HTTP::Daemon or HTTP::Daemon::SSL.METHODS
They are inherited from the JSON::RPC::Server methods basically. The below methods are implemented in JSON::RPC::Server::Daemon.- new
- Creates new JSON::RPC::Server::Daemon object. Arguments are passed to HTTP::Daemon or HTTP::Daemon::SSL.
- handle
- Runs server object and returns a response.
- retrieve_json_from_post
- retrieves a JSON request from the body in POST method.
- retrieve_json_from_get
- In the protocol v1.1, 'GET' request method is also allowable. it retrieves a JSON request from the query string in GET method.
- response
- returns a response JSON data to a client.
